Image forming apparatus and image forming method determining characteristic relating image data and density

Downtime relating to formation and detection of a detection image is reduced. An image forming apparatus includes a controller configured to calculate a first conversion unit to convert a gradation of input image data so that density output for the input image data becomes a first density output characteristic based on a first detection result of the detection image detected by a density sensor in a first mode. The controller generates a second conversion unit to convert the gradation of the input image data so that the density output for the input image data becomes a second density output characteristic in a second mode based on the detection result in the first mode and correction information, and further updates the correction information based on a second detection result of the detection image detected by the density sensor in the second mode and the first detection result.

Image forming apparatus

An image forming apparatus forms a plurality of images of different colors on an intermediate transfer belt by a plurality of image forming portions. The image forming apparatus detects a color misregistration amount of the image formed on the intermediate transfer belt and performs image formation using a correction value based on the color misregistration amount. If an elapsed time from previous image formation is less than a predetermined time, the image forming apparatus predicts the correction value using the previous correction value and the temperature at that time and performs color misregistration correction. If the elapsed time from the previous image formation is a predetermined time or longer, the image forming apparatus predicts the correction value using the correction value and the temperature at the time when the elapsed time becomes a predetermined time or longer and performs the color misregistration correction.

Image density correction for an image forming apparatus
10948864 · 2021-03-16 · ·

An image forming apparatus includes an image bearer, an image forming section, an image density difference detector, and control circuitry. The image forming section is configured to form a gradation image pattern on a surface of the image bearer. The gradation image pattern includes gradation images having different image densities stepwise in a sub-scanning direction. The image density difference detector is configured to detect image density differences in a main scanning direction of the gradation images. The control circuitry is configured to execute an image density difference correction mode that corrects the image density differences in the main scanning direction based on detection results detected by the image density difference detector.

IMAGE FORMING APPARATUS INCLUDING A DETECTION UNIT CONFIGURED TO DETECT A DENSITY OF A REFERENCE TONER IMAGE
20210080887 · 2021-03-18 · ·

An image forming apparatus includes a detection unit that optically detects a density of a reference toner image for density measurement formed on an image carrier. Either a first detection method for detecting the density of the reference toner image by receiving specularly reflected light reflected by the image carrier and the reference toner image for density measurement formed on the image carrier or a second detection method for detecting the density of the reference toner image by receiving diffusely reflected light from the image carrier and the reference toner image, is selected in accordance with color information of a toner, the color information being stored beforehand in a storage unit, and the density of the reference toner image is optically detected.

CORRECTING IN-TRACK ERRORS IN A LINEAR PRINTHEAD
20210073601 · 2021-03-11 ·

A method for correcting in-track position errors in a digital printing system having a linear printhead includes printing a test target including a plurality of alignment marks. A data processing system is used to automatically analyze a captured image of the printed test target to determine a measured in-track position for each of the alignment marks. The measured in-track positions for the alignment marks are compared to reference positions to determine measured in-track position errors. An in-track position correction function is determined responsive to the measured in-track position errors, wherein the in-track position correction function specifies in-track position corrections to be applied as a function of cross-track position. A corrected digital image is determined by resampling an input digital image responsive to the in-track position correction function.
